About Coryl Jing Jun Lee
Coryl Jing Jun Lee is a scholar working on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ment, Polymers and Plastics and Environmental Chemistry, having authored 19 papers that have together received 699 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(6 papers), Quantum Dots Synthesis And Properties (2 papers), High-Temperature Coating Behaviors (2 papers), Copper-based nanomaterials and applications (2 papers), Electrocatalysts for Energy Conversion (2 papers), Iron oxide chemistry and applications (2 papers), Mine drainage and remediation techniques (2 papers) and Particle Dynamics in Fluid Flows (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(293 citations), Materials Chemistry (388 citations) and Electrochemistry (44 citations). Coryl Jing Jun Lee has collaborated with scholars based in Singapore, China and United States. Frequent co-authors include Dongzhi Chi, Yee‐Fun Lim, Chin Sheng Chua, T. S. Andy Hor, Si Yin Tee, Ming‐Yong Han, Robert Raja, Debbie Hwee Leng Seng, He‐Kuan Luo and Siew Lang Teo. Their work appears in journ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, ACS Nano and Chemical Communications.
